If you are one of those people who is wishing to do so, here are some tips for finding one of these courses online.The first step to take is to look for a service provider that specialises in training programmes and is ideally based within the city itself. The reason for this is that, if based in London, the training provider is far more able to help you find great opportunities on the ground in the city. This can include finding the best teachers, the best accommodation and the cheapest transport options.When working with a London-based company, you are essentially cutting out the middle man who could be a partner or an intermediary of a training provider that is not based in the city. This leads to greater efficiency and even lower prices in many cases, which is a bonus for participants seen as London is one of the most expensive cities in the world to live in, work in and visit.The next thing that you should look for in a training company that advertises their London business courses online is accreditation, to make sure that you paying for and receiving a high standard of professional training. Two of the more common accreditation to look for include Continuing Professional Development (CPD) and IAO approval.There are many training providers advertising their courses online, and looking for accreditation is the best way to ensure that you choose a programme is worth the money that you are paying for it. In some cases, courses will also come with certification at the end of the programme as proof of your progress or qualification in a certain subject.After this, check to see that the training provider offers various means of customer support for all the participants that take its courses. Some providers that offer a great business course do not have offices that you can visit, instead relying solely on an online presence.Although this can lower prices for participants on a business course and make finding and enrolling on courses easier, the downside is that this can also mean that customer support is lacking. Instead, look for a service provider that offers extensive telephone and email support, and even other support features such as a mobile app or online chat.By following these tips you are much more likely to find a training provider online that is well worth your investment.
